Wallback (zip 25285), West Virginia gets a BestPlaces Cost of Living score of 85.6, which means the total cost of housing, food, childcare, transportation, healthcare, taxes, and other necessities is 14.4% lower than the U.S. average and 7.8% lower than the average for West Virginia.

Zip 25285 (Wallback, WV)

Housing costs in Wallback?
A typical home costs $105,100, which is 68.9% less expensive than the national average of $338,100 and 24.8% less expensive than the average West Virginia home, at $139,700. Renting a two-bedroom unit in Wallback costs $740 per month, which is 48.3% cheaper than the national average of $1,430 and 16.2% cheaper than the state average of $860.

Can I afford Wallback?
To live comfortably in Wallback (zip 25285), West Virginia, a minimum annual income of $20,160 for a family, and $24,400 for a single person is recommended.
